BPT Optima S.A., SICAR acquires VERTAS, part of Vilniaus Vartai

BPT Optima
Baltic Property Trust Optima S.A, SICAR
has acquired the 15 storey 9800 sq.m. office property VERTAS, which
is a significant part of the Vilniaus Vartai development. This
business center is outstanding both in terms of quality and
location, and serves as the main domicile for international tenants
such as Citco, Cisco Systems, Eli Lilly, Nycomed, SAP and several
government institutions, including the Ministry of Finance.
"Vilniaus vartai" is the first
commercial and living luxury district in the Baltics and was
officially opened on the 26th of October 2007. It embraces 37
luxurious boutiques, 3 restaurants, a lounge bar and the globally
famous "Pacha" night club. "Vilniaus vartai" has been established
with the vision of attracting fashion, style, modern art and
quality leisure opportunities to Vilnius.
The Grand Opening ceremony of
"Vilniaus vartai" was the largest private gathering that Vilnius
has seen so far and it has been unofficially declared as the
celebration of the decade. More than 1000 guests were invited
including the Prime Minister of Lithuania, other government
representatives, personalities from spheres of culture, art and
fashion locally and from abroad.
The first part of the Grand Opening was offered as a present to
the whole city of Vilnius. Approximately 50.000 people were
watching the unique light performance created by Gert Hof, the
worldwide famous German light artist. The show was featured by
music created especially for this event by the most famous
contemporary Lithuanian composer - Linas Rimša. The composition was
performed by the National Symphonic Orchestra.
